I work from home in addition to my 9-5. Here's what I do, eventually it will scale to be liveable.

>Freelance web development work
I make about $200-800 per month taking on different projects. It's nice, but it is actual work and not a get rich quick scheme. The benefit is that I am good and charge $55 per hour, after commissions, processing fees and taxes I'm averaging $30 per hour, which is real cool. There is not a ton of work available with my skill set but if you are a developer with a wide knowledge you can make a living on this alone

>Trading stocks/fx
I make a modest $100-300 per month trading. I use strict parameters and try to make no more than 10 trades per month in each market. My risk/reward is 2% of my account size, if I'm profitable on 6/10 trades per month I make 2%, which comes to 24% annually. I generally stop trading for the month or get more strict if I'm up above 4%.

>Driving for Uber
This isn't working from home, but I make about $150 per week driving for Uber in the afternoons. I try to hop on when it is raining or during peak hours so that I can make more money, it's usually 5-10 hours a week max.
